Clay offers endless creative possibilities. The ceramics area contains gas and electric kilns for both high and low temperature firing as well as outdoor facilities for raku and sawdust firings. When you study ceramics you will be able to develop technical skills in hand building slip casting glazing and firing as well as engage in contemporary art practices like installation and digital imagery with your work.
